Oracle Apex 页面进程调用存储过程不起作用

问题描述 投票:0回答:1

我创建了一个主详细信息页面。在母版页上,我创建了一个页面进程,它在单击按钮时调用存储过程并将主记录保存在表中,这按预期工作正常。在详细信息页面上,我创建了类似的页面进程,它在单击按钮时调用存储过程,并期望将详细记录保存在表中,但是当单击按钮时,它会显示消息“行已成功更新”,但实际上没有行插入到表中。无法弄清楚为什么记录没有插入到表中。当直接从数据库调用时,该过程运行良好。

这是我的页面流程 - 插入选项 Page Process

Page Process Properties

Page Process Properties

这是我添加详细记录的页面。

Detail record adding

当我单击“创建”按钮时,记录未插入到表中。

after clicking Create button

我期待记录被插入到详细表中。

oracle oracle-apex
1个回答
0
投票

目前,进程按以下顺序执行:

  • 关闭对话框
  • 插入选项

这意味着对话框被关闭并且......没有其他事情发生。所以,切换他们的位置到

  • 插入选项
  • 关闭对话框
© www.soinside.com 2019 - 2024. All rights reserved.